引言
对于经常使用网络的用户来说,Shadowrocket是一款相当广泛应用的工具,但许多人对其服务器的原理知之甚少。本文将系统性地探讨Shadowrocket服务器原理,旨在帮助用户深入理解其工作机制与使用方法。
Shadowrocket简介
Shadowrocket是一款iOS平台下的网络代理工具,旨在提升用户的网络访问速度和安全性。通过搭建和使用其对应的服务器,用户可以绕过地域限制,访问被封锁的网页和内容。
Shadowrocket服务器的工作机制
1. 基础工作原理
Shadowrocket作为一个代理工具,其核心功能就是数据传输。它通过设置一种协议(如HTTP或HTTPS),将用户请求的数据发送至指定的服务器,再由服务器解析请求并返回结果。这一过程涉及以下几个环节:
- 设置代理: 在Shadowrocket中设置代理地址和端口。
- 数据转发: 请求会先发送到Shadowrocket,再转发到目标服务器。
- 结果返回: 目标服务器将数据结果通过Shadowrocket送回用户设备。
2. 不同类型的代理协议
在使用Shadowrocket时,可以选择不同的代理协议,这也是其灵活性的体现,包括但不限于:
- Shadowsocks: 一种高效的安全代理协议,适合大多数用户。
- Vmess: 所有类型的异步代理协议,适合更高级的用户。
- Trojan: 针对特定需求优化的代理协议具备更隐蔽性。
3. 数据加密与安全增强
通过使用加密手段,Shadowrocket确保用户数据在传送过程中的安全性。这包括:
- TLS/SSL加密: 数据在网络中被加密,这样即便数据被截取也无法被解读。
- 安全隧道: Shadowrocket建立安全隧道来保护用户的隐私数据。
Shadowrocket服务器的功能特性
1. 快速稳定的连接
得益于其高效的代理设计和多样化的服务器选择,用户在使用Shadowrocket时可以获得快速且稳定的网络连接。
2. 支持多种平台
Shadowrocket不仅支持iOS平台,在其他操作系统上(如Android和Windows)也有相应的工具来实现相似的功能。
3. 大量的服务器选择
用户可以根据自身需求选择不同地区的服务器,以便更好地获得内容。例如:
- 美国服务器: 适合访问美国地区的内容。
- 中国香港服务器: 提供良好的访问速度和稳定性。
4. 用户友好的界面
Shadowrocket的设置界面直观易懂,支持用户在短时间内完成配置与使用。
Shadowrocket如何使用
1. 下载与安装
用户需要在App Store中搜索并下载Shadowrocket,请注意检查更新,以获得更好的使用体验。
2. 服务器配置
安装完毕后,用户需以下列格式添加服务器:
- 类型(如Shadowsocks)
- 地址
- 端口
- 密码
- 加密方式
- 额外选项(如插件等)
3. 启动与测试
配置完成后,用户可以通过开启连接测试其运行效果。此时应确保Shadowrocket代理与系统的网络可正常互动。
4. 高级设置(可选)
如果用户需要,可以对连接进行细节调整,包括DNS设置、流量代理等。该部分功能可确保Shadowrocket在使用中的灵活性。
常见问题解答
Shadowrocket能在Windows上使用吗?
Shadowrocket主要是为iOS设备设计的,Windows用户通常需要寻找其他类似的工具如“SS_WIN”或者“V2Ray”。
如何选择合适的服务器?
选择服务器主要依赖于用户的地理位置、资费及特殊需求,比如一定要收看某一地区的内容,可以设定最近的美国或特定国家的服务器。
可以同时使用多个国内外代理吗?
一般情况下,Shadowrocket不允许同时开启多个代理。但通过不同配置文件,用户可以为特定的需求切换不同的服务器,实现一定的资源共享。
购买服务后无法连接怎么办?
首先确认配置参数是否设置正确,其次检查网络环境。这边问题通常在于配置错误或网络防火墙问题。
总结
通过对Shadowrocket服务器原理的详细了解,用户可高效利用其网络优势,保障访问的灵活性和安全性。在需要更深入的使用中,请参考更多相关的使用教程,以提升Shadowrocket的应用体验。